Artificial Intelligence in Healthcare Market Overview

As per the analysis conducted by Market Research Future (MRFR), the global artificial intelligence in healthcare market is estimated to garner a market value of USD 12.22 billion while expanding at a CAGR of 51.9% during the assessment period from 2018 to 2023.

The increasing volume of healthcare data and the growing complexities of datasets are expected to increase the need for AI, which can grow the market in the coming time. The increasing healthcare data and rising amount of cross-industry alliances and agreements are predicted to strengthen the industry in the forecast tenure. On the contrary, the high costs associated with AI systems are anticipated to hamper the market growth during the assessment tenure. However, the emerging players in the developing countries are likely to offer lucrative opportunities that can counter the impeding cause and augment the AI in healthcare market size.

The transmission of COVID-19 through human contact can be controlled by the usage of robots and AI, which can lessen the risk of transmission by reducing human contact, protecting administrative staff and healthcare workers. For example, NCS Singapore deployed Robotic Process Automation (RPA) solution to automate the admission, discharge, and transfer of patients, which was initially performed manually.

Artificial Intelligence in Healthcare Market Segmentation

The segmental analysis of the global artificial intelligence in healthcare market is done by technology, types, application, and end-user.

The technology-based segments of the global Artificial Intelligence in Healthcare Market are pattern recognition, context awareness, language and image processing, deep learning, querying, and others.

The types-based segments of the global Artificial Intelligence in Healthcare Market are software, hardware, and services. Among all, the hardware segment is estimated to procure the maximum growth while thriving at a CAGR of 52.4% during the assessment tenure.

The application-based segments of the global Artificial Intelligence in Healthcare Market are clinical trials, virtual nursing assistants, robot-assisted surgery, preliminary diagnosis, automated image diagnosis, and dosage error reduction. Among all, the automatic image diagnostic segment is likely to witness the highest CAGR of 52.5% during the assessment timeframe.

The end-user segments of the global Artificial Intelligence in Healthcare Market are pharmaceutical & biotechnology companies, academic & research laboratories, and hospitals & diagnostic centers. Among all, the hospitals and research centers are expected to procure significant traction during the forecast period.

Artificial Intelligence In Healthcare Market Regional Analysis

The global Artificial Intelligence in Healthcare Market is predicted to be dominated by North America during the forecast period. The rapid expansion of the biotechnology industry in the region can be recognized as one of the most significant cause that can grow the regional market. The on-going AI innovations and launch of products are anticipated to be another salient cause that can strengthen the market during the forecast period. Furthermore, the rising partnerships among key players are expected to enhance the AI in healthcare market during the forecast period.

For example, BioMarin and Deep Genomics have announced their collaboration to discover and develop oligonucleotide drug candidates for four rare diseases. The partnership is anticipated to aid in propelling the market growth during the forecast period. On the other hand, APAC is projected to be the fastest-growing market while thriving at a CAGR of 52.4 percent during the review tenure. The rising number of startups in the region is expected to contribute significantly in the coming tenure. For instance, Healthtech startup MFine has raised USD 16 million in funding led by Heritas Capital. Europe is anticipated to procure the second largest market share during the forecast period. The rise of the European market can be attributed to the increasing R&D investment. MEA can display sluggish growth during the projection period. The Middle East countries are anticipated to make a significant contribution in developing the regional market owing to their economic stability.
